We report experimental results related to transformations of the quasicrystalline phases in alloys of Al-Cu-Co-Fe to crystalline structures. The alloys were fabricated by normal casting methods under inert gas atmospheres. Icosahedral and decagonal quasicrystalline phases were found to coexist. Annealing induces transformation from quasicrystalline to crystalline structures. Evidence of crystallization is clearly obtained from electron diffraction patterns along the two-fold axes. Low magnification dark field images suggest that twins are formed by the deformation mechanism associated with the transformation.
